#1: Understanding Sound Measurement Methodology for Camp Stoves
Before diving into specific models, let's clarify how decibel measurements work in camping contexts. Based on independent testing I've observed (including industry-standard practices), reliable stove noise assessment requires:
- Consistent environment: Measurements taken in the same location to eliminate variables
- Standardized distance: Typically 6-12 inches from burner (mimicking pot placement)
- Controlled conditions: Wind speed under 5 mph, similar ambient temperature
- Full-throttle operation: Testing maximum output as well as simmer settings
- Five-second average: Filtering out momentary spikes for consistent readings
A critical detail often overlooked: the same stove's sound level measured outdoors and in a small room may vary by about 10 dB. This is why field testing matters more than lab results for campers.

When reviewing "quietest" claims, verify the sound measurement methodology. Many manufacturers test stoves in ideal conditions that don't reflect real-world wind, temperature, or terrain. Look for third-party verification and consistent testing protocols that align with how you'll actually use the stove.

#4: Wind Management Strategies That Reduce Noise Impact
Unexpectedly, wind management directly affects stove noise. Here's how to create quieter setups:
- Use proper windscreens: Creates a more stable flame that burns quieter than a wind-tossed one
- Position stoves behind natural barriers: Rocks or gentle terrain depressions block both wind and sound propagation
- Angle stove away from wildlife corridors: Directs noise away from sensitive areas
- Simmer instead of boil: Reduces both noise and fuel consumption
Critical note: Never enclose canister stoves completely (this creates dangerous pressure buildup). Proper wind management requires at least 25% open space around the burner.

#5: Stealth Camping Equipment Essentials Beyond Your Stove
True wildlife-friendly camping requires looking beyond just your stove:
- Heat exchanger pots: Reduce boil time, thus minimizing noise duration
- Silicone pot lifters: Eliminate clanging metal noises when adjusting cookware
- Dedicated camp kitchen area: Position at least 70m from wildlife trails and water sources
- Cooking schedule planning: Avoid peak wildlife activity periods (dawn/dusk)
- Rubberized stove bases: Prevent vibration noise on hard surfaces
Inclusive menu notes: Plan one-pot meals that minimize noisy pot shifting and water pouring. Dishes like curries, soups, and stews that simmer gently create less cooking noise than methods requiring frequent stirring or flipping.
